Explanation / Answer

1) Mass value starts from Zero. So, it will be a Ratio. Ratio has a true zero point like ratio, proportions, scale..etc

2) Most affected by outliers is the standard deviation.

The standard deviation is a measure of dispersion from a mean. If observation is an outlier then variation between mean and observation will be more.

Range= Maximum-Minimum(It also affected by an outlier)

IQR= Interquartile range= Q3-Q1( Middle 50% data in the boxplot)

3)The data distribution in a Boxplot:

Less than Q1=25%

Q1-Q2= 25%

Q2-Q3=25%

>Q3= 25%

4) When mean, median and mode are same, then the distribution of data to be approximately symmetrical and data distributed normally as standard normal distribution.
